Job Summary

The Business Office Coordinator manages and coordinates all functions of accounting, including accounts receivable, general ledger, and money reconciliation. Manages accounts including all payments, billing, claim submission and follow-up. Provides customer service and reception duties at the front entry and on the telephone/switchboard. Must possess strong communication skills, be detail oriented and work well with fellow peers. Must have computer experience. Professional appearance and manner required. Works under limited supervision. Must be well versed on electronic billing. Working knowledge of state regulations.

Qualifications

Associate's degree in a health care or business related field required. In lieu of degree, three years applicable experience may be accepted. Minimum of three years of applicable experience preferred. Previous experience in a healthcare setting preferred. Three years' experience in a leadership role preferred. Must be knowledgeable of the billing requirements of third party payers. Basic understanding of medical terminology as well as ICD-9, CPT coding, and good working knowledge of general business procedures, accounting principles, and computer programs required.
